App:mergeExtDexDebug FAILED из-за отсутствия файла lifecycle-livedata-core-2.8.3-runtime.jarAndroid

Форум для тех, кто программирует под Android
Ответить
Anonymous
 App:mergeExtDexDebug FAILED из-за отсутствия файла lifecycle-livedata-core-2.8.3-runtime.jar

Сообщение Anonymous »

Я просто пытался обновить свой проект с версии targetSDK 33 до версии 34. Для этого мне также нужно обновить некоторые API жизненного цикла. Раньше пользовался этими версиями

Код: Выделить всё

//LifeCycle
implementation 'androidx.lifecycle:lifecycle-common:2.2.0'
implementation 'androidx.lifecycle:lifecycle-runtime:2.2.0'
implementation 'android.arch.lifecycle:extensions:2.2.0'
implementation 'androidx.lifecycle:lifecycle-livedata-ktx:2.2.0'
implementation 'androidx.lifecycle:lifecycle-runtime-ktx:2.2.0'

Которое я обновил

Код: Выделить всё

//LifeCycle
def lifecycle_version = "2.8.3"
def arch_version = "2.2.0"

// ViewModel
implementation "androidx.lifecycle:lifecycle-viewmodel-ktx:$lifecycle_version"
// LiveData
implementation "androidx.lifecycle:lifecycle-livedata-ktx:$lifecycle_version"
// Lifecycles only (without ViewModel or LiveData)
implementation "androidx.lifecycle:lifecycle-runtime-ktx:$lifecycle_version"
// Saved state module for ViewModel
implementation "androidx.lifecycle:lifecycle-viewmodel-savedstate:$lifecycle_version"
// Annotation processor
kapt "androidx.lifecycle:lifecycle-compiler:$lifecycle_version"

Но теперь отображается ошибка, которую я не понимаю.
Ошибка
*
Задача :app:mergeExtDexDebug ОШИБКА
AGPBI: {"kind":"error","text":"java.lang.NullPointerException","sources":[{"file":"/Users/apple/.gradle/caches/transfo rms-3/826f48ce73a7e66fbb6d1694a1db726c/transformed/lifecycle-livedata-core-2.8.3-runtime.jar"}],"tool":"D8" />*
Изображение

Что я уже пробовал:
  • Очистить проект -> перестроить проект // не работает
  • Аннулировать кеш со всеми включенными флажками () -> сделать недействительным и перезапустить // не работает
Пожалуйста, помогите мне, если кто-нибудь сталкивался с этой проблемой или имеет какие-либо идеи. Спасибо

Подробнее здесь: https://stackoverflow.com/questions/787 ... untime-jar
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»